Beautifully presented, two bedroom, third floor apartment with private parking and visitor parking, situated in an exclusive modern development offering easy access to superb transportation and convenient shopping facilities.
Internally the property measures an impressive 703 square feet and comprises; a double aspect open plan reception room which incorporates a modern, high end, fitted kitchen and access to your private, balcony. There are two spacious, double sized bedrooms and a large family sized bathroom with shower in bath.
Located within a peaceful modern development with a great community feel, this property is only a short walk to both Westcombe Park and Charlton railway stations which benefit from frequent trains into the City; providing direct access to London Bridge and Cannon Street via the Southeastern service and Blackfriars, Farringdon and London St Pancras via the Thameslink service. Just 1 stop from Charlton is Woolwich, from which you can access the Elizabeth line. There are numerous bus links offering easy access to North Greenwich, Greenwich and Blackheath for entertainment, markets, museums, parks and restaurants or simply to hop on the DLR or Jubilee line.
Convenient shopping facilities are a short stroll away via the numerous Charlton retail parks giving you access to multiple supermarkets, all within a 5-10 minute walk (Asda, Sainsburys, Lidl, Aldi, Marks&Spencers as well as many other stores including Boots, Next, tk Maxx, Primark, Starbucks and Costa. Additionally, there are 2 gyms within the retail parks and many highly rated local eateries in the vicinity. The East Greenwich Pleasance, Charlton Park and Greenwich Park are all nearby and walkable.
The property further benefits from being in the catchment area for multiple ofsted Outstanding Primary schools as well as being just a 3 minute walk from the highly regarded Monkey Puzzle Charlton Day Nursery & Preschool. Lastly, there is plentiful on-site residents parking and a long lease remains.
